Jose Mourinho might not be showing Paul Pogba any affection at the moment but the same can't be said about the staff at The Lowry hotel in Manchester.
Mourinho's growing rift with Pogba took another turn this week when they two were caught on film at Manchester United's Carrington training complex arguing.
After taking Friday's training session, Mourinho return to where he has been living since he became United manager in the summer of 2016.
He got out of his car before giving the bellboy a hug and entered the hotel lobby.

The cameras were present as part of a bi-monthly opportunity to film training afforded to Sky as part of their contract with the Premier League.
It is rare for such a row to be caught on camera but the filming was something Mourinho was well aware was happening and could easily have postponed.
Wednesday's session had been pencilled in given it was expected to be a light warm-down following an easy win over Derby in Carabao Cup.
However, following the humiliating home defeat, Mourinho opted not to cancel the presence of three broadcasters - Premier League Productions and MUTV were also there - and to confront Pogba in front of them at the start of the session.
Mourinho and his former vice-captain have been locked in an increasingly bitter power struggle all year, with Pogba angling for a move to Barcelona.
There appeared to have been a thawing in the relationship at the start of the season with Pogba stepping in as captain in the absence of regular skipper Antonio Valencia.
But the Frenchman's comments in the wake of Saturday's 1-1 draw with Wolves, where he urged Mourinho to be more attacking, led to a dressing down in front of his team-mates in training on Monday when he was told he'd never captain United again.
Pogba was rested for the defeat by Derby on Wednesday night but irritated Mourinho again by posting a video on Instagram of him laughing with team-mate Andreas Pereira and Luke Shaw after defeat.
That was the subject of Wednesday's row, when Mourinho could he heard saying to press officer John Allen, 'John, when did Paul post on Instagram?', as the pair exchanged glares and heated words.
Allen was present as it was due to be a filmed session.
Sportsmail revealed on Wednesday that problems between Mourinho and Pogba began on the day he signed over two years ago, with the United boss unhappy with the way in which his then-world-record transfer was announced.
Mourinho felt that the social media-led announcement involving grime artist Stormzy put the player above the club.
